INTEGRATED CIRCUITS DATA SHEET TDA1515BQ 24 W BTL or 2 x 12 W stereo car radio power amplifier Product speci cation File under Integrated Circuits IC01 July 1994 Philips Semiconductors Product speci cation 24 W BTL or 2 x 12 W stereo car radio power ampli er TDA1515BQ The TDA1515BQ is a monolithic integrated class B output amplifier in a 13 lead single in line SIL plastic power package The device is primarily developed for car radio applications and also to drive low impedance loads down to 1 6 At a supply voltage VP 14 4 V an output power of 24 W can be delivered into a 4 BTL Bridge Tied Load or when used as stereo amplifier it delivers 2 12 W into 2 or 2 7 W into 4 Special features are flexibility in use mono BTL as well as stereo high output power low offset voltage at the output important for BTL large usable gain variation very good ripple rejection internal limited bandwidth for high frequencies low stand by current possibility typ 1 A to simplify required switches TTL drive possible low number and small sized external components high reliability The following currently required protections are incorporated in the circuit These protections also have po
